|
ru.linux- RU.LINUX --------------------------------------------------------------------- From : Alexandr Leykin 2:4613/82 27 Oct 2005 22:22:09 To : All Subject : Dynamic Linking -------------------------------------------------------------------------------- Привет All! Есть вопрос: Либа есть большая *.a в ней кучу *.so, разрабатывалась множеством людей. Есть программа ELF бинарник под линукс (берет экстерном ф-ции из вышеуказанной либы), как пострипать большую либу так чтобы в ней остались только ф-ции (и зависимые) для работоспособности только этого бинарника.... p.s. нужно для дистрибуции группы проектов, которые используют одну либу, но в либе есть и частные ф-ции (реализации алгоритмов) которые в дистрибутив входить не будут (например будут использованы в новых версиях, или уже не используемые(использовались в старых релизах))... p.p.s. ручками что знаю стрипаю от версии к версии. p.p.s2 - статическую линковку не предлагать по причине того что бинарник разрастается в десятки раз. С уважением, Alexandr 27 октября 2005 года --- * Origin: Hет, я не хакер, просто плохо спал... (2:4613/82)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.linux/184943612968.html, оценка из 5, голосов 10
|